#63d9df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63d9df is composed of 38.8% red, 85.1%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.6% cyan, 2.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 182.9 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 63.1%. #63d9df color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#00b3bf.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#63d9df
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010707 is the darkest color, while #f5f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#63d9df
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9da5a5 is the less saturated color, while #46f3fc is the most saturated one.
